发明名称 CONTINUOUSLY VARIABLE TRANSMISSION DEVICE
摘要 PROBLEM TO BE SOLVED: To provide a continuously variable transmission device including a meshing means installed on a shaft in the V-groove bottom of each pulley and a driving force transmitting means meshed with the meshing means for transmitting the driving force, eliminating the risk of the meshing means attacking the transmitting means and free of the risk of obstructing the cooperative motion of the two means. SOLUTION: The continuously variable transmission device includes the driving force transmitting means (chain 13) set over between two pulleys (drive pulley 11 and driven pulley 12) with variable groove widths so that the rotational driving force of one pulley can be transmitted to the other. It further includes a part to be meshed (recess 17a) on the pulley wind side of the driving force transmitting means and a movable meshing part (movable teeth 16) so provided on the shaft of the pulley (pulley shaft part 14) as to be movable in the shaft in radial direction for emerging and retracting to/from the shaft part and put in the emerging condition so as to be able to mesh with the part to be meshed when the shifting region is at least in either the maximum Hi range or the maximum Lo range.
